Dubai Bling

Dubai Bling is a 4-year-old with a knack for finding the frame but a trickier time crossing the line first. With two wins from eleven races, the horse wins roughly one in every five or six outings — modest by top-level standards, but respectable enough for the level at which it competes. What's more telling than the bare numbers is how the wins have come: a breakthrough victory at Haydock Park back in June 2024, then a second win at Ascot six weeks ago. The recent form tells an interesting story. After that Ascot win in July, the horse has had a tougher spell, with only one place finish from the last five races — a second just yesterday. That's the kind of form that keeps the yard hopeful but frustrated: Dubai Bling has enough ability to get into the frame regularly (six places across the career), yet seems to struggle with consistency at the business end. The last six races read as a pattern of not-quite-there performances, punctuated by that recent second-place finish. It suggests the horse is still in the mix but currently lacking the edge needed to win.

Training-wise, Dubai Bling is in the care of Hugo Palmer at Malpas in Cheshire, a yard that has already sent out 67 winners this season — a solid operation with plenty of activity. For a 4-year-old with two wins to its name, that kind of stable environment offers both opportunity and competition. The horse has raced eleven times now and still appears to have room to find more wins, but the window for it to establish itself as a meaningful competitor is gradually narrowing. At this stage, it's a horse that has shown it can win on the big stage but hasn't yet found the consistency to do so regularly.
